## Deployment

Quick notes for whoever inherits WireSquish next. This service terminates websocket connections for the Bramleyville dashboard, and compression is the big tradeoff: permessage-deflate saves us real bandwidth on chatty clients but chews CPU at peak. We landed on compressing only frames over a size threshold, with a modest window. Don't crank the window up without load-testing — we've been burned. Deploys are rolling, two pods at a time. Current production settings are below.

service settings:
HOLIX_HOST=holix.qorvelsys.internal
HOLIX_PORT=7000

**Release checklist — Ledgerline 4.2**

Verify spreadsheet export memory usage stays under the 512 MB ceiling when exporting workbooks above 200k rows. The Tallow team found last cycle that the XLSX writer buffered entire sheets before flushing; the new streaming path in the Quillport module should prevent this, but we need confirmation on both the staging and perf clusters. Run the large-export soak for 30 minutes and attach the heap snapshots to this item. Verified runs must reference the build below.

pipeline stamp: htk3_adb

☐ Canteen orientation. The ground-floor canteen at Farrowgate Court is shared with staff from Lindqvist Analytics next door, so expect unfamiliar faces at lunch — that's normal. Meals are card-only and hot service ends at 14:00. The connecting door from our side locks automatically after 10:00; to get back through after lunch, enter the door code below.

staff pass of kawep-hahap = bdg-IEUUF-6

Subject: Vendored fonts now bundled — action for plugin authors

All,

As of Trellick 4.2, third-party fonts are vendored into the core bundle. Plugins must stop fetching Glyphora and Norden Sans at runtime; reference the bundled families via the @trellick/fonts package instead. Remote font loads will be blocked by CSP starting next release. Licensing review is done — redistribution is covered under our vendored terms. Test your plugin against the staging build and confirm glyph rendering. The relevant build token follows.

pipeline stamp: htk9_6ce9d33c5